Chestnut-backed Chickadee vs Yellow-browed Sparrow
Poecile rufescens compared with Ammodramus aurifrons
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Chestnut-backed Chickadee | Yellow-browed Sparrow |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Aves (Birds)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order same | Passeriformes (Songbirds) | Passeriformes (Songbirds) |
| Family | Paridae | Passerellidae |
| Genus | Poecile | Ammodramus |
| Species | Poecile rufescens | Ammodramus aurifrons |
Evolutionary Relationship
Chestnut-backed Chickadee and Yellow-browed Sparrow share a common ancestor at the Order level: Passeriformes. (Songbirds)
